Acquisition of the Austrian ATB Group (2011)

In 2011, Wolong expanded its technical base by acquiring 97.94% of the Austrian ATB Group, one of Europe's top three motor manufacturers. This acquisition integrated the famous Morley and Laurence Scott brands.

  • Morley Motors: Over 130 years of history in underground coal mining. Renowned globally for robust build quality, high power output, and exceptional reliability.
  • Laurence Scott: Famous for low-starting-current motors, high-capacity naval generators, and pioneering drive installations in British nuclear power stations.

Motor Rotor Component Structure

1. The Rotor Assembly

Our rotors feature a robust squirrel-cage design. For standard and medium-sized industrial motors, cast aluminum rotors are manufactured using centrifugal casting or advanced die-casting techniques. This melts pure aluminum directly into the slots of the laminated rotor core, creating a single-piece component that integrates the rotor bars and end rings.

This integrated construction prevents bar breakage during high-torque starting cycles. For larger, high-voltage motors, copper-bar rotors are utilized. By employing state-of-the-art induction welding for end rings and secure bar anchoring, these copper rotors deliver outstanding electrical conductivity and withstand severe thermal shocks.

2. Advanced Stator Insulation

Stator windings are crafted using double-polyester film combined with reinforced glass cloth wraps and high-grade mica tapes. Our automated processing lines wind and shape the coils before they undergo the crucial Vacuum Pressure Impregnation (VPI) cycle.

The VPI process extracts air and moisture from the stator slot, replacing it with a specialized thermosetting resin. This creates a solid, void-free insulation structure that provides exceptional dielectric strength, resistance to chemical solvents, moisture ingress, and thermal degradation. The system is designed to meet Class F thermal limits while operating within Class B rise margins.

3. Rugged Cast Iron Frame

The motor frames are engineered using multi-physics structural and fluid simulation programs. The casting profile provides generous thermal dissipation surfaces, thick structural ribs, and excellent mechanical damping properties.

Constructed from high-tensile gray cast iron, our frames offer exceptional structural rigidity, protecting the stator core and bearings from external mechanical shocks. Dynamic balancing simulations guarantee that the frame eliminates natural resonant frequencies, resulting in low vibration levels, long bearing life, and low acoustic output.

4. Low-Noise Fan Hood System

Our cooling solution includes a modern fan cover, integrated air guides, a protective inlet window, and noise attenuating silencer plates. The air inlet is positioned on the side to prevent blockage, maintain ventilation, and reduce air turbulences.

By utilizing sound-dampening materials within the airflow path, overall motor noise is reduced by up to 5 dB(A). The fan system features an IP22/IP55 protective housing, preventing fingers or foreign objects from contacting the moving fan blade.

Frequently Asked Questions

Technical explanations regarding cast iron motors, explosion-proof standards, and global logistics support.

What are the mechanical benefits of cast iron motor frames over cast aluminum?

Cast iron (GG25/GG30) offers significantly higher mechanical rigidity and vibrational damping than cast aluminum. In high-torque applications, cast iron frames effectively absorb vibrations, preventing bearing misalignment and structural fatigue. They also provide better resistance to corrosive chemical environments and high mechanical impacts.

How does the VPI insulation system protect high-voltage stator windings?

Vacuum Pressure Impregnation (VPI) extracts all air and moisture from the stator slots, replacing them with a highly viscous, solvent-free protective resin. This eliminates air voids, increases dielectric strength, improves heat dissipation, and prevents moisture ingress, making the motor suitable for highly humid environments.

What is the difference between ATEX, IECEx, and TestSafe certifications?

ATEX is a mandatory European Union directive for explosion safety. IECEx is an international conformity assessment system for equipment used in explosive atmospheres. TestSafe is Australia's certification body, specializing in coal mining safety. Our products hold all three certifications, allowing them to be imported and operated globally.

Can these cast iron motors operate under variable frequency drives (VFD)?

Yes, our WEBP3 and TBVF series are specifically designed for variable speed drive (VSD/VFD) operation. They feature reinforced insulation systems to withstand high voltage spikes, insulated bearings on the non-drive end to prevent circulating shaft currents, and separate cooling fans for continuous low-speed operations.

How does the low-noise fan hood achieve decibel reduction?

The fan hood utilizes a side-inlet design that prevents airflow obstructions. Integrated air guides and acoustic lining plates absorb high-frequency noise from air turbulences, reducing operational noise levels by up to 5 dB(A) compared to traditional designs.
